REINSTATEMENT ORDER

We abated this appeal to the trial court because appellant's brief was overdue. The trial court conducted a hearing and determined that appellant was indigent and wished to continue with the appeal. The trial court also removed appellant's appointed counsel from the representation of appellant and appointed E. Alan Bennett to represent appellant in the appeal.

Accordingly, this appeal is reinstated. Appellant's brief is due 20 days from the date of this Order.

PER CURIAM Before Chief Justice Gray, Justice Davis, and Justice Scoggins
Appeal reinstated
